Wolverines Fall to Iowa in Big Ten Tournament Final

COLUMBUS, Ohio -- The No. 5-ranked University of Michigan field hockey team suffered a 4-1 loss against No. 6 Iowa in the Big Ten Conference Tournament championship game on Sunday (Nov. 4) at Ohio State's North Turf Field.
Iowa took the first lead as Katie Naughton took advantage of a Hawkeye flurry around the U-M cage to push in the rebound goal at 16:20. Junior/sophomore goalkeeper Paige Pickett(Dallas, Texas/Episcopal School of Dallas) stopped a close shot from Caitlin McCurdy -- but the ball kicked out to the right side of the circle, where Naughton corralled it and dumped it into the near-side corner.
The Hawkeyes padded their advantage just five minutes later, successfully converting their second penalty corner of the contest to take a 2-0 lead into the halftime break. Lauren Pfeiffer scored on the direct shot, hammering a low shot on goal that hit Pickett and redirected to the bottom right corner.
The Wolverines pressured in the early moments of the second half, drawing a pair of penalty corners and peppering Iowa goalkeeper Lisa Munley with four low shots through the opening 10 minutes of the frame. The Hawkeyes withstood the barrage, however, and responded with a goal at the 45:49 mark to push their lead to 3-0. The ball was batted around in the U-M circle before Jess Werley picked it up on the left side of the cage and, using a tight angle, bounced it behind Pickett into the opposite corner.
Michigan found the back of the Hawkeye cage less than four minutes later -- at 49:13 -- as senior Ashley Lennington(Carlisle, Pa./Carlisle HS) earned her second marker of the tournament on a rebound in front of the goal. Sophomore Kelly Fitzpatrick (Hummelstown, Pa./Palmyra Area HS) took the intitial shot, a point-blank attempt from the penalty-stroke area. Munley sprawled to make the save, but the rebound came out to Lennington, who lifted a shot over the laid-out Iowa goalkeeper to cut the gap to two goals.
Iowa added an insurance goal late in the second half to seal up the victory as Werley picked up her second tally of the game with just 1:23 remaining on the clock. Blaum carried the ball across the circle from the right side and fed a pass to Werley, who one-timed it in from the left goalpost.
The Hawkeyes narrowly outshot Michigan 12-11 but were out-cornered by the Wolverines 7-4. Pickett earned five saves in the U-M cage, while Munley stopped six of Michigan's seven shots on goal.
Fifth-year senior Kristen Tiner (Houston, Texas/The Kinkaid School) and sophomore Paige Laytos (Lititz, Pa./Warwick HS) were selected as Michigan's respresentatives on the Big Ten All-Tournament team.
Michigan will await the NCAA Championship selections on Tuesday (Nov. 6) at 8 p.m. The 16-team tournament opens with first- and second-round matches Saturday and Sunday, Nov. 10-11, at four campus sites to be announced. The selection show will be aired live on CSTV and on www.NCAAsports.com.
